在 Vue 3 中,利用数组的 filter 方法配合箭头函数是最直接、高效且语义清晰的解决方案。
在 Vue 3 中,利用数组的 filter 方法配合箭头函数是最直接、高效且语义清晰的解决方案。
核心方案
使用 Array.prototype.filter 方法,遍历 tableDataSource.value,保留那些 id 属性存在于 selectedProducts.value 数组中的对象。
1. 基础写法(推荐)
// 假设
// const tableDataSource = reactive([
// { id: 1, name: ...